Yard Drain Installation in Tuscaloosa, AL
Yard drain installation services focus on creating effective drainage solutions to manage excess water on residential properties. These projects typically involve installing systems such as French drains, surface drains, or underground piping to redirect water away from foundations, basements, and landscaped areas. Property owners often request these services to prevent water pooling, reduce soil erosion, and protect structures from water damage,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or poor drainage conditions.
Before requesting yard drain installation, homeowners should consider the layout of their property, including the slope of the land and existing drainage issues. It’s helpful to understand the specific areas where water tends to collect and any landscaping features that might influence the drainage plan. Clarifying the type of drainage system desired and any existing underground utilities can also aid in designing an effective solution that meets the property’s needs.

Yard Drain Installation Questions
What is yard drain installation? Yard drain installation involves adding drainage systems to direct excess water away from the property, preventing pooling and water damage.
Why is yard drainage important? Proper drainage helps protect landscaping, foundations, and basements by reducing standing water and soil erosion around the property.
What types of yard drains are commonly used? Common options include surface drains, French drains, and channel drains, each suited to different yard layouts and water runoff needs.
When should yard drain installation be considered? Installation is recommended when there are persistent pooling issues, uneven yard slopes, or after heavy rainfall causes water accumulation.
